因此,我正在使用ASP.NET Core为我的存储库构建一个基本的电子商务站点。我用我所称的“ProductInventory”表来跟踪商店中一个产品的库存,该表中有一个名为' stock‘的整数列。现在我不希望股票是负的,所以即使在更新查询之前我已经检查了软件,但仍然有可能两个用户可能同时签出,从而产生两个可能导致否定的更新查询。所以我想我用一个case语句来决定减去多少。到目前为止,我想出的是这个。CASE WHEN [
我正在港口下进行我的nextjs项目,当使用getStaticProps时,我的后端api是不可用的(也在docker下)。因此,我通过networks连接前端,如果我为api请求硬编码api,它就能工作。但是,当我试图利用serverRuntimeConfig和publicRuntimeConfig以便在它们之间切换时,取决于代码的运行位置,我得到了{} for serverRuntimeConfig。我的next.config.<